Consumer Spending Rises 0.6%

[Stay on top of transportation news: .]

Consumer personal spending rose 0.6% in August, the biggest in four months, the Commerce Department said Friday.

The gain followed a 0.4% increase in July. Personal incomes rose 0.3% following a 0.5% rise, Commerce said.

The spending gain was greater than economists’ forecasts of a 0.4% increase, Bloomberg reported.

An increase in consumer spending could increase demand for new factory goods and the trucking shipments that get them to stores.
